Transaction 80d3f3b265adc299bd9a2c69e048062433af711a92eb9531f8ff4c4bc27330e8
1 Input
1 Output
-
80d3f3b265adc299bd9a2c69e048062433af711a92eb9531f8ff4c4bc27330e8:0
- value
- 498868
- script pubkey
- OP_0 OP_PUSHBYTES_20 fb16acd17dcecee24bd300f7bc1d628535bf12c8
- address
- bc1qlvt2e5taem8wyj7nqrmmc8tzs56m7ykgyey5l8